BlackRock Income Trust, Inc. (NYSE:BKT) Short Interest Update

BlackRock Income Trust, Inc. (NYSE:BKTGet Free Report) saw a large increase in short interest in December. As of December 31st, there was short interest totalling 49,400 shares, an increase of 12.3% from the December 15th total of 44,000 shares. Based on an average trading volume of 61,200 shares, the days-to-cover ratio is currently 0.8 days.

BlackRock Income Trust Dividend Announcement

The firm also recently declared a monthly dividend, which will be paid on Friday, January 31st. Stockholders of record on Wednesday, January 15th will be issued a dividend of $0.0882 per share. The ex-dividend date of this dividend is Wednesday, January 15th. This represents a $1.06 dividend on an annualized basis and a dividend yield of 9.10%.

BlackRock Income Trust, Inc is a closed ended fixed income mutual fund launched by BlackRock, Inc The fund is managed by BlackRock Advisors, LLC.
